A » Milk powder is produced by removing water from milk through evaporation and spray drying. Initially, milk is pasteurized and concentrated to reduce its water content. The concentrated milk is then sprayed into a hot chamber, where the remaining water evaporates, leaving behind dry milk particles that are collected as powder. This process ensures shelf stability while retaining essential nutrients.

A »Milk powders are produced by removing water from milk through spray drying or drum drying. In spray drying, milk is sprayed into a hot air chamber where water evaporates, leaving behind fine milk particles. In drum drying, milk is spread over heated drums, and the water evaporates, forming a thin film that is scraped off and ground into powder. This process helps preserve milk for extended storage and transport.
